BIOGRAPHY

John Barnes won two league titles, two FA Cups, one League Cup, a PFA Player of the Year award and two Football Writers’ Player of the Year awards while with Liverpool. Barnes was unstoppable between 1987-1990 when he was at the peak of his powers.

In 1984 he scored a wonder goal for England against Brazil in Rio. Despite 79 caps for England he would always be remembered for that remarkable strike, coming just a year after his international debut. A gifted passer with great touch, Barnes converted from the dangerous striker of his Watford days to a cultured midfielder.
